Focus Hotels has announced the appointment of Noel McMeel as the executive head chef at Bedford Hotel Belfast.

McMeel has had a distinguished career having cooked for royalty, presidents, celebrities and diplomats. Among his many career highlights is his role in designing the G8 Summit menu that showcased Ireland’s finest local ingredients to world leaders.

At The Bedford Hotel, McMeel will oversee all culinary operations, from the hotel’s signature restaurant to private dining and bespoke events.

In addition to leading The Bedford Hotel’s culinary development, McMeel will establish a training and mentorship programme for emerging chefs, designed to support skills development, innovation, and long-term retention within Northern Ireland’s hospitality industry.

Mike Gatt, general manager of The Bedford Hotel Belfast, said: “Noel’s appointment represents a cornerstone in our vision to make The Bedford Hotel a culinary landmark for Belfast. His reputation for excellence and his deep respect for Northern Irish ingredients align perfectly with our ethos. Together, we will set a new benchmark for food and hospitality in the city.”

McMeel added: “Joining The Bedford Hotel is about more than a kitchen, it’s about creating a movement. We’re building a destination that celebrates Ireland’s food story, from the soil to the plate. My mission is to craft a culinary experience that’s honest, sustainable, and bursting with local character while creating an environment that inspires and nurtures the next generation of talent.”

The Bedford is managed by hotel management company Focus Hotels.
